1. What is an exception in Kotlin?

An exception is an event that occurs during the execution of a program, disrupting the normal flow of instructions.


2. How are exceptions represented in Kotlin?

Exceptions in Kotlin are represented by classes that inherit from the Throwable class.

5. What is the purpose of the finally block in exception handling?

The finally block contains code that is executed whether an exception is thrown or not, making it useful for cleanup operations.


6. How are multiple catch blocks handled in Kotlin?

The catch blocks are evaluated from top to bottom, and the first one with a matching exception type is executed.

11. How can you use the use function for resource management in Kotlin?

The use function is an extension function on Closeable resources and ensures that the resource is closed when the block is exited.

19. What is the role of the UncaughtExceptionHandler in Kotlin?

The UncaughtExceptionHandler allows you to set a global exception handler for uncaught exceptions in a thread.


20. How can you create a custom exception handler for the entire application in Kotlin?

By setting a custom UncaughtExceptionHandler using Thread.setDefaultUncaughtExceptionHandler.
